McLaren, the sports car maker, has unveiled the MSO version of its GT super sports car as a 2020 model and is a supercar in both the exterior and interior components.

The British company was keen to introduce its own model «McLaren GT MSO», during its participation in the festival «Pebble Beach Concourse Diligence» in the United States of America, especially since the festival is now linked annually to the unveiling of the latest super sports models, in the same way to present the company «Bugatti French company for its new car «Chantodichi», which costs up to 8.9 million US dollars (32.6 million dirhams).

Although the GT MSO retains the traditional lines of the modern McLaren models, the 2020 model has a black-and-gray exterior as well as new high-volume headlamps pulled into both ends of the car with LED technology. The front bumper with sporty corners, a long hood and large ventilation holes on both sides of the car also enters the air to cool the engine in the rear of the car.

The rear lines, in turn, received large sporting components that stand out clearly with the rear wing, and the car is equipped with high-volume lamps and a tiller underneath the polished titanium exhaust grille.

The sports components continued to impose themselves in the interior of the car, with the sporty design of the seats covered with Kashmiri leather, varying degrees of color between white and gray, woven using threads «Geoform Stitching» in a sewing design inspired by the design of the engineering umbrella of the British Museum.

The headrests and side sills also received the MSO logo, compared to McLaren's dependence on carbon fiber components to make several cabin components, and are clearly featured with the transmission lever and side levers behind the steering wheel.

Winged doors

In its special edition, the MSO 2020, McLaren maintained the concept of winged doors, which is the historical legacy of the super sports models produced by the company since its famous F1 car in 1991.
